Descriptions from Across the Web
- Hidden Greens Golf Course is an 18-hole regulation length golf course in Hastings, Minnesota. This short layout will reward good shots and provide a fun golf outing for everyone. Online tee times may be available at Hidden Greens Golf Course ... more on TheGolfCourses.net
- This course features large and fast greens, plus tree-lined fairways that afford generous landing areas. In addition, water hazards come into play on five holes. The signature hole is #16, a 395-yard, par 4, requiring a tee shot ... more on Golf.com
